Mahakal Temple Ujjain Town

The ancient Mahakaleshwar Temple, nestled in the sacred city of Ujjain Town, holds immense religious significance in Hinduism. Its origin dates back millennia, with beliefs suggesting its establishment during the Puranic period. The temple is one of the twelve important Jyotirlingas, a representation of Lord Shiva, making it a prime pilgrimage destination. Seeing the deity to the Mahakaleshwar deity is considered highly fortunate, and the Bhasma Aarti, a unique morning ritual involving sacred ash from the cremation pyre, draws worshippers from across the world.
